Great amenities, great location, great price!
We recently spent 3 nights at this apartment and were more than satisfied. We may have been the only guests there but that is our fault for going in December but we had everything we could need. The kitchen/living area was huge and everything was brand spanking new. There was a large fridge freezer, a microwave and a cooker. 2 huge bed settees and a twin bedded room. the bathroom was great. It was a few minutes walk to the Marina bars - which were all - can you guess? great! and then another 10 minutes walk to the town. The old town of Lagos is truly lovely. The shops and restaurants are great and the prices unbelievably cheap. It is half an hour to most places you would want to visit in the area (Sagres, Cape St Vincent, Luz, Ponte de Piedade ) and then maybe just over an hour if you want to go up to the mountains at Monchique. And only an hour from Faro airport - we much preferred this part of the Algarve to the more eastern part.

Fabulous apartments, great location
We are a couple from Ireland in our early 30s, just back from a week at the Marina Club in Lagos. Absolutely fabulous! We took the advice from other TripAdvisor reviewers and asked for a pool/harbour view. It was definitely worth it. The apartments at the other side of the building overlooked a car park and some had no views at all (e.g. big trees or other buildings in front of them). Our apartment overlooked the pool and a bit of the marina which was fabulous. The apartment itself was really modern, spotlessly clean, spacious and bright with patio doors in both the bedroom and the living room leading to the balcony. It is located a short stroll from the marina and about a ten minute walk to the town or the beach. Lagos is a great town with loads of restaurants, cafes and bars, little cobbled streets and small shops. Unlike many other resorts, you really feel like you're in Portugal (instead of little England/Ireland/Germany!). Most of the restaurants are Portuguese (specialising in fish/seafood). Very good - recommended
Had a great week staying at the Marina Club in Lagos. Our room was spacious and very clean with generally good facilities. The only downside was that our balcony was on the sea view side of the apartment block, but unfortunately the sea is about 1km away and in between is the road, the car park (very handy and spacious), some wasteland, a school, and the railway station. So get a pool view if you can! The staff were friendly and helpful, letting us stay until 4pm on our departure day, even though we should have been out by 12:00. The pool was very big, clean and quiet - lots of sunbeds. Airbeds are not allowed though and the rules also didn't allow ball-games etc (though the staff were tolerant of them) so not really a place for lively kids! Good for the rest of us though. Lagos is great too - lively (in a good way) and atmospheric, lots of bars, restaurants, and street entertainment. I'd definitely come here again.
delightful holiday
We have just returned from a weeks vacation. The holiday was almost faultless. Arrived in Faro airport, took a short taxi ride to train station €10,and got train direct to Lagos €6 each. Train journey was long -1hr45mins but pleasant and interesting. Hotel is a ten minute walk from train station. Reception was formal and business like and surprised us both as we expected staff to be a little more warm and .friendly. However, after seeing our studio apartment which was large, bright and well fitted out, our hearts rose and remained high for the rest of the week. The swimming pool was large and clean with plenty of sun loungers. The marina was close by and the town was a very pleasant 10 /15 minute walk away. There is a large supermarket at the back of the hotel which is very convenient. There are a good selection of restaurants in the town and eating out is inexpensive . Our experience in this hotel was of a well run and efficient establishment with excellent facilities but staffed by people who were not overly helpful.
